Yashhtej Industries reported audited financial results for FY2026 with revenue declining 17% to Rs. 26,938.50 lakhs from Rs. 32,569.10 lakhs in FY2025. Despite the revenue drop, PAT grew 18% to Rs. 1,252.66 lakhs (vs Rs. 1,062.45 lakhs), with EBITDA margin expanding from 6.8% to 8.4%. The company completed an IPO in February 2026 raising Rs. 8,887.56 lakhs through 80.79 lakh equity shares. The board meeting held on May 29, 2026 also approved new appointments for secretarial auditors (M/s H M Kadeval & Associates) and internal auditors (M/s Kabra & Maliwal). Operating cash flow turned sharply negative at Rs. 5,313.42 lakhs due to significant inventory buildup (Rs. 6,038.04 lakhs increase) and rise in other non-current assets (Rs. 5,502.94 lakhs). Total borrowings increased substantially to fund working capital and expansion needs.
Revenue decline of 17% is concerning, but improved profitability margins and successful IPO provide some support. The significant negative operating cash flow and rising debt levels pose risks to financial stability and warrant close monitoring.
